Goat Yoga

Photo by Bret Redman

Yes, it’s exactly what it sounds like. This unconventional yoga class partners your favorite furry friends with your favorite workout. Prepare to be surrounded by the 15-20 of the cutest baby pygmy goats while striking some yoga poses for a great sweat session (and an even better photo op.)

Mermaid School

Look at this class. Isn’t it neat? Dallas kids (and adults!) can make their mermaid dream complete at Adventure Scuba and Snorkeling Center’s honorary mermaid introductory class. Arrive to the pool 10-15 minutes early to get your tail, and don’t forget a swimsuit, towel, and goggles. Get your core burning and reveal your inner mermaid with this majestic workout experience.

Dallas School of Burlesque

Courtesy of Dallas School of Burlesque

Dance your way to a rockin’ bod at the Dallas School of Burlesque. This unique fitness studio has many different styles of dance including hip hop, chair dance, ballroom dance, and of course, burlesque. Not in the mood to dance? Check out some of their other one-of-a-kind workouts like aerial yoga, beginners lyra (aka hula hoop acrobatics), and “naughty pilates.”

Hiking Yoga

Courtesy of Cardio Yoga Fusion

Love hiking? Dig yoga? Then you’ve found yourself a fitness match made in heaven with this challenging and rewarding workout adventure. Cardio Yoga Fusion meshes the practice of the yogi’s with hiking in the great outdoors. Group sessions are every Saturday at 9am on the Katy Trail.

City Surf Fitness

Courtesy of Dallas Fitness Ambassadors

Surfing in the city is definitely a thing thanks to City Surf Fitness and their variety of refreshingly different take on exercise. Engage in a fat blasting, balance challenging, full body workout completed on the Ripsurfer X machine. If you thought surfing wasn’t a workout. Think again.
